
Final Day At ITA Regionals Yields Beach Champions
10/26/2008 12:00:00 AM | Women's Tennis
Oct. 26, 2008
San Diego, Calif. - Long Beach State's time at the ITA Regionals came to close Sunday, as the 49ers still had four players in competition. Stephanie Jeanes and Deborah Armstrong shared top billing on the day, both reaching the consolation singles finals.
Armstrong took down UC Santa Barbara's Rachel Murphy to finish on top of her half of the back draw, while Jeanes won a 6-4, 6-3 decision over Katie Williams of UNLV. The 49er coaches decided to not have the teammates play each other for the consolation title, and instead the shared the honor of each reaching the finals.
In doubles action, Jeanes and her partner Hannah Grady were finally stopped in the main draw, falling to second-seeded Hein and McKenna of Arizona State in an excellent 9-7 match. In the back draw, Armstrong and Lisa Sutton picked up a win to move to the consolation finals over Oki and Regatta of UC Riverside 8-6, but lost in the championship 8-6 to Kobuch and Peter of Hawai'i.
Sunday's action concludes the 49ers competition for the fall. Long Beach State tennis will be back in action in January for team play.
